Some state worker's compensation acts also provide that a formal claim for compensation be made, either to the employer, the compensation board, or to the state commission board with notice to the employer that the claim is being made. This claim or notice of claim is different from the notice of injury and is governed by a different, and sometimes longer, statute of limitations. This form is a generic example that may be referred to when preparing such a form for your particular state. It is for illustrative purposes only. Local laws should be consulted to determine any specific requirements for such a form in a particular jurisdiction.

Oregon’s Workers' Comp system offers financial support for employees facing work-related injuries. When you're hurt on the job, you must inform your employer right away. Your employer will guide you through the process of getting medical treatment and filing a claim. Understanding your rights in Oregon can help you navigate this system more effectively.

When speaking with a Workers' Comp adjuster, avoid making careless comments about your injury or its severity. You should never downplay your situation or admit fault. It’s crucial to stick to the facts of your work-related injury. This approach helps maintain your claim’s integrity and increases your chances of receiving the benefits you need.

Minnesota Workers' Comp provides benefits to employees who suffer work-related injuries. When an employee is injured, they should report the incident to their employer. The employer must then file a claim with the state's workers' compensation system. It's essential to understand your rights to ensure you receive the benefits you deserve.

What is a Social Security Benefit Statement? A Social Security 1099 or 1042S Benefit Statement, also called an SSA-1099 or SSA-1042S, is a tax form that shows the total amount of benefits you received from Social Security in the previous year.
